Process of Configuring Siebel Search for Third-Party Search Engines
Siebel Search can work with any third-party search engine, provided that the third-party search engine has a Web service endpoint. If the third-party search engine has a Web service endpoint, then Siebel Search can do the following:
Send indexing and search requests to the Web service endpoint.
Receive responses and display the responses in the Siebel application’s Search Results view.
To set up third-party search engines for integration with Siebel Search, perform the following tasks. Note that the third-party Elastic Search Engine is used as an example in the tasks in this process.
Write a Web service for your Search Engine and host it on a Web server.
